Pepperoni Pizza Pumpkins are a charming and delicious twist on classic pizza bites, perfect for any occasion! These adorable snacks combine gooey mozzarella with savory pepperoni, all wrapped in a festive pumpkin shape. Ideal for Halloween parties, Thanksgiving gatherings, or simply as fun lunch box treats, these mini delights are sure to impress. With their easy preparation and playful presentation, they make an exciting appetizer or snack that will please kids and adults alike. Ingredients
- 1 can refrigerated pizza pie crust
- 2 tablespoons marinara sauce (plus extra for serving)
- 16 slices of pepperoni
- 8 mini mozzarella balls (or cubes)
- 1 egg (slightly beaten with 2 teaspoons water)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Roll out the pizza dough on a floured surface and cut out eight circles using a round cutter.
- Place a dollop of marinara sauce in the center of each circle, add two slices of pepperoni, and one mozzarella ball.
- Gather the edges up over the filling and seal tightly to form balls.
- Wrap kitchen twine around each ball to create pumpkin shapes.
- Brush with egg wash and bake for 15-20 minutes until golden brown.
- Let cool slightly before removing twine and serving warm with marinara.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
